What is FOXHOUND Special Forces?
High-Tech Special Forces Unit FOXHOUND was a small, formidable elite black ops unit of the United States Army that was established by the “Legendary Soldier” Big Boss. It was officially disbanded by the U.S. Government after 2005.
Why did Big Boss create FOXHOUND?
It was formed by Big Boss and Major Zero after the events of Metal Gear Solid: Portable Ops. In the game, members of the FOX unit turned rogue so FOXHOUND was formed to kill the rogue members.

What are the four foxhound breeds?
Within the breed, there are four types of American Foxhound: field-trial hounds, which have great speed and competitive spirit; fox-hunting hounds, which are known to work slowly, with a musical voice; trail hounds, which race or hunt following an artificial lure; and pack hounds, which are used in large packs, by …
